基于Google的云计算实例分析.doc
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
【云计算基础概念】 云计算是一种基于互联网的计算方式,它通过共享计算资源,提供灵活的、按需访问的计算服务。这种服务模式使得用户无需直接拥有硬件设备,而是通过网络访问和使用计算能力、存储空间以及各种软件应用。云计算的核心概念包括虚拟化、效用计算、基础设施即服务(IaaS)、平台即服务(PaaS)和软件即服务(SaaS)。它融合了并行计算、分布式计算和网格计算的技术特点,实现了大规模数据处理和计算资源的高效利用。 1.1.1 虚拟化 虚拟化是云计算的基础,它允许多个操作系统和应用程序在同一物理硬件上运行,提高了资源利用率和管理效率。 1.1.2 效用计算 效用计算借鉴了电力行业的“按需付费”模式,用户只需为实际使用的计算资源付费,不必承担闲置资源的成本。 1.1.3 IaaS、PaaS和SaaS IaaS提供基础设施,如计算、存储和网络资源;PaaS提供开发、测试和部署应用的平台;SaaS则提供完整的应用程序,用户可以直接使用而无需自行维护底层基础设施。 【Google的云计算实例】 Google作为云计算领域的先驱,其云计算平台基于一系列核心技术,包括: 1.2 Google文件系统(GFS) GFS是Google设计的分布式文件系统,能够处理PB级别的数据,提供高可用性和容错性,支持大规模并行数据处理。 1.3 分布式数据库BigTable BigTable是一个分布式多维度排序的表,用于存储海量结构化和半结构化数据。它是Google许多在线服务(如Google搜索、Gmail和Google Maps)背后的关键技术。 1.4 Map/Reduce编程模式 Map/Reduce是一种处理大数据集的编程模型,通过将任务分解为可并行执行的子任务(Map阶段),然后整合结果(Reduce阶段),实现大规模数据处理的效率提升。 【挑战与前景】 尽管云计算带来了显著的效益,但同时也面临诸多挑战,如数据安全、隐私保护、服务质量保证、跨云互操作性以及合规性问题。随着区块链技术的发展,这些问题有望得到缓解。区块链的去中心化、不可篡改和透明性特性可以增强云计算的安全性和信任度。 总结来说,云计算是信息技术的重要进展,Google在此领域的实践为全球范围内的企业和开发者提供了高效、经济的计算解决方案。随着技术的不断进步和应用场景的拓展,云计算将持续改变我们工作和生活的方式,而区块链等新技术的融入将进一步优化云计算的性能和安全性。
- 粉丝: 30
- 资源: 5万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助